EC7A SERIES
10 WATT 2:1 INPUT RANGE
DC-DC CONVERTERS
FEATURES
* 10W Isolated Output
* DIP-24 / SMD Metal Package
* Very High Efficiency up to 89%
* 2:1 Input Range
* Regulated Outputs
* PI Input Filter
* Continuous Short Circuit Protection
* No Tantalum Capacitor Inside
* CE Mark Meets 2004/108/EC
* UL60950-1 Approval
